• Skip to main content
  • Skip to primary sidebar

Master Your Tech

Mobile phones, software, consumer electronic how-to guides

  • iPhone
  • Excel
  • Powerpoint
  • Word
  • Google Drive
  • Tech
  • Guides
You are here: Home / Guides / How to Enable Hyper-V Windows 11: Step-by-Step Guide

How to Enable Hyper-V Windows 11: Step-by-Step Guide

posted on February 18, 2026

How to Enable Hyper-V on Windows 11

Enabling Hyper-V on Windows 11 allows you to create and run virtual machines directly on your computer. This is useful for testing software, running different operating systems, or even setting up a test environment for development. You’ll need to ensure that your machine supports virtualization in the BIOS and then activate Hyper-V through Windows Features. Here’s a quick guide to get you started.

How to Enable Hyper-V on Windows 11

By following the steps below, you’ll have Hyper-V up and running on your Windows 11 machine. This will allow you to create virtual environments effortlessly.

Step 1: Check System Requirements

Ensure your PC supports virtualization.

Before enabling Hyper-V, make sure your computer supports virtualization. You can usually find this information in your computer’s BIOS settings. Look for Intel VT-x or AMD-V.

Step 2: Access BIOS

Restart your computer and enter the BIOS.

Access the BIOS by pressing a specific key during startup, like F2 or DEL. This allows you to enable virtualization technology if it’s not already turned on.

Step 3: Open Windows Features

Go to Control Panel and find Windows Features.

In your Windows search bar, type "Turn Windows features on or off" and select it. This is where you can enable Hyper-V.

Step 4: Enable Hyper-V

Check the box for Hyper-V.

In the Windows Features window, find Hyper-V, check the box next to it, and click OK. Windows will install the necessary components.

Step 5: Restart Your Computer

Reboot for changes to take effect.

Once the installation is complete, restart your computer to finalize the changes. Hyper-V will now be active.

Once you’ve completed these steps, you’ll notice a new Hyper-V Manager tool in your system. This tool lets you create and manage virtual machines, opening up a world of possibilities for testing and development.

Tips for Enabling Hyper-V on Windows 11

  • Verify Compatibility: Make sure your processor supports SLAT (Second Level Address Translation).
  • Check Windows Version: Hyper-V is available on Windows 11 Pro, Enterprise, and Education editions.
  • Allocate Resources Wisely: Ensure your system has sufficient RAM and CPU resources to run virtual machines effectively.
  • Backup Your Data: Always back up important data before making significant system changes.
  • Keep BIOS Updated: An updated BIOS can prevent compatibility issues.

Frequently Asked Questions

What is Hyper-V?

Hyper-V is a virtualization technology from Microsoft that allows you to create and run virtual machines.

Do all Windows 11 editions support Hyper-V?

No, only the Pro, Enterprise, and Education editions support Hyper-V.

Can I enable Hyper-V without BIOS support?

No, your CPU must support virtualization, which is enabled in the BIOS.

Is there any performance impact?

Running virtual machines can consume significant resources, which may affect performance if your system is not well-equipped.

How do I disable Hyper-V?

You can disable Hyper-V by unchecking it in the Windows Features dialog.

Summary

  1. Check system requirements.
  2. Access BIOS.
  3. Open Windows Features.
  4. Enable Hyper-V.
  5. Restart your computer.

Conclusion

Enabling Hyper-V on Windows 11 opens up a whole new world of possibilities for tech enthusiasts and professionals alike. Whether you’re a developer testing applications across different operating systems or a power user exploring new software, Hyper-V offers a flexible and powerful solution.

While setting it up is relatively straightforward, it’s crucial to ensure that your system meets all the necessary requirements. Don’t rush the process. Take the time to verify compatibility, allocate resources wisely, and keep your BIOS updated. These small steps can make a big difference in your virtualization experience.

If you’re new to virtualization, start by experimenting with small virtual machines. This way, you can get a feel for the environment without overwhelming your system’s resources. And remember, the tech community is vast and full of resources. Don’t hesitate to reach out or explore forums if you run into any hurdles.

With Hyper-V, you’re not just running software; you’re entering a sandbox where creativity and innovation can thrive. So, why not dive in and explore the endless possibilities?

Matthew Burleigh
Matthew Burleigh

Matthew Burleigh has been a freelance writer since the early 2000s. You can find his writing all over the Web, where his content has collectively been read millions of times.

Matthew received his Master’s degree in Computer Science, then spent over a decade as an IT consultant for small businesses before focusing on writing and website creation.

The topics he covers for MasterYourTech.com include iPhones, Microsoft Office, and Google Apps.

You can read his full bio here.

Share this:

  • Click to share on X (Opens in new window) X
  • Click to share on Facebook (Opens in new window) Facebook

Related posts:

  • How to Enable Hyper-V on Windows 10: A Step-by-Step Guide
  • How to Disable Hyper-V in Windows 11: A Step-by-Step Guide
  • How to Disable Hyper-V on Windows 10: A Step-by-Step Guide
  • How to Enable the On Screen Keyboard in Windows 11: A Step-by-Step Guide
  • How to Enable Secure Boot Windows 11: A Step-by-Step Guide
  • How to Enable Virtualization on Windows 11: A Step-by-Step Guide
  • How to Enable Windows Defender: A Step-by-Step Guide for Users
  • How to Enable Virtualization Windows 10: A Step-by-Step Guide
  • How to Enable Remote Desktop Windows 10: A Step-by-Step Guide
  • How to Enable RDP on Windows 10: A Step-by-Step Guide
  • How to Enable Remote Desktop on Windows 10: A Step-by-Step Guide
  • How to Enable Virtualization in BIOS Windows 10: A Step-by-Step Guide

Filed Under: Guides

Search

Primary Sidebar

Latest Posts

  • How to Change Taskbar Size in Windows 11: A Simple Guide
  • How to Skip Microsoft Sign-In on Windows 11: A Step-by-Step Guide
  • How to Scan for Malware on Windows 11: A Comprehensive Guide
  • How to Update Windows 11: A Step-by-Step Guide for Users
  • How to Refresh Screen in Windows 11: A Step-by-Step Guide
  • Contact Us
  • Privacy Policy
  • Terms and Conditions

Copyright © 2026 MasterYourTech.com